Leadership Review Briefing — for the board. Quick one: we've been approached about acquiring Pellwick Dynamics, the sensor outfit out of Greyharbour. Early numbers look decent, culture fit seems fine, and their Aldervane contract alone could justify the price. Diligence would take six weeks. We'd like a steer before talks go further. Our working position is set out in the note below.

internal memo for kawip-hadug: Headcount on the Wenwyn team goes from 7 to 140 by the end of January. Gross margin on Wenwyn came in at 20 percent against a plan of 15 percent.

**Runbook: Flume gateway — websocket compression**

Quick recap for the sync: permessage-deflate saves us ~40% bandwidth on the Flume gateway, but CPU on the edge pods spikes during market-open bursts. We're keeping compression on for payloads over 1KB and skipping it for heartbeats. If edge CPU crosses 80%, flip the `flume.compress` flag off and page whoever's on deck. To run the toggle script against the staging gateway, authenticate with the key below.

service key, fawip-bajef: kto11_Qt5wZK9vdNC

- [ ] Step 7: Archive cold storage buckets (Glacierline tier). Confirm both ceremony witnesses are present, verify bucket manifests match the Oxbow ledger, then seal the archive key shares. Plugin authors may observe but not handle shares. Once sealed, the archive index itself is encrypted and can only be reopened with the passphrase below.

vault phrase of badup-hahig = tamael-aldael-kelmir-istael-fenok-istwyn-tamius-jorath-oliion

Q: The old turnstiles at Harrowfield Depot have been replaced — do night staff need new credentials? A: Yes. The new Gatewarden units installed last week read pass codes instead of swipe cards. Your old card will not work after midnight Sunday. Tailgating triggers an alarm, so badge in individually. For night-shift access, enter the code shown below.

door code, kawip-bagap: bdg-HQEWH-4

## Onboarding — Markdown Pipeline (Inkmere)

Inkmere docs render through a three-stage pipeline: parse, sanitize, emit. Releases rebuild all templates; never hot-patch emitted HTML. Broken renders usually mean a sanitizer rule change — check the rules diff first. The render cluster only accepts builds from the release channel, and every build artifact must be signed before upload. Sign artifacts with the deploy key below.

release key, hafop-tajef: bky13_s2vaFVNJTHfBL